WebNov 28, 2024 · Fred Jangle became the first native-born South African to win the tournament in 1922. Not surprisingly, Gary Player has the most South African Open victories, with 13. Bobby Locke was the youngest champion at age 17, and went on to win nine titles. Charles Bolling and Fred Wadsworth are the only US winners of the South African Open.

Web100 0 _ ‎‡a Sid Brews ‏ ‎‡c professional golfer ‏ 4xx's: Alternate Name Forms (12) 400 1 _ ‎‡a Brews, Sid, ‏ ‎‡d d. 1972 ‏ crystal glass chicagoSydney Francis Brews (29 May 1899 – 1972) was a South African professional golfer. Brews was born in Blackheath, London, England. He turned pro in 1914 and emigrated to South Africa in 1924.
